Lucas is the one that I am not sold on. I think we would be better off with someone like Lamela or Lo Celso who actually picks their head up. Lucas for all his althetisicm, he just doesn’t get his head up and move the ball. He would rather dribble.

I do think Mourinho will go with Dier and Ndombele. He will want some girth in there. The interesting thing about today was that Dier was playing further forward than Winks when we had the ball. Mourinho clearly told him to let Winks take the ball off the back line when the ball didn’t go long.

I can’t guess how we will play for the rest of the year, but I hope we don’t just become a lump it forward type of team even though we did win many of the second balls. I just don’t think that will work against stronger sides that are on form. We will have to be confident in our play and interlink from the middle third to the final third.

Mou has always wanted Toby, he’s going to be the main guy in the back now. Outside of that, Dele, Son and Kane will likely always start. If a Ndombele can stay fit I would say him as well. Dier seems to be the only DM option and I don’t see Jose playing without a true #4. Everything else is a bit fluid.
 
Fun to speculate but far too early to really tell. The other Jose trait we have seen is for him to take a player and move them to what is not a traditional position for them.
 
Pretty much that, though I wouldn’t rule out Lloris getting his place back, Walker-Peters or Foyth taking the RB position, and possibly Lo Celso or Lamela competing with Moura. Possibly Sessegnon instead of Davies.

I actually rate Aurier, but just see him as too hot-headed. Lloris would probably be a good fit for a tactical approach that doesn’t rely on a keeper being able to pass a ball. I love Moura and would be happy for him to be a regular starter, but he’s the most likely to lose out against Dele and Son.

Sessegnon could be the one that really misses out. I really rate him and think he was a massive signing, but he fits the wing-back formation more than a flat back four. Maybe with Foyth at RB and Dier as a DM there’s more flexibility to allow Sessegnon to roam forward, but that doesn’t seem to be Mourinho’s style
